Here’s a roadmap to help you navigate contract disputes and keep your startup protected:
1. Review the Terms of the Contract 📑
The first step in handling any dispute is to thoroughly review the terms of the contract. Understand what was agreed upon and whether there has been a breach. Often, a misunderstanding can be resolved by clarifying the terms and intentions of both parties.
2. Open Communication and Negotiation 💬
Start with an open dialogue. Sometimes, disputes arise due to miscommunication. Engaging in a friendly conversation can often resolve the issue before it escalates. Negotiation and compromise can lead to mutually beneficial solutions without involving legal action.
3. Mediation and Arbitration ⚖️
If direct communication doesn’t work, consider mediation or arbitration. These alternative dispute resolution methods are quicker and less expensive than going to court. A neutral third party helps both sides reach an agreement without the need for a trial.
4. Seek Legal Counsel 🕵️♂️
If the dispute can’t be resolved informally, it’s time to seek legal advice. A lawyer can review the contract, help you understand your legal rights, and provide advice on the next steps. They may also draft a formal demand letter or help with litigation if necessary.
5. Breach of Contract and Legal Remedies ⚖️
If one party has breached the contract, legal remedies may include damages, specific performance, or termination of the contract. Knowing your options allows you to protect your business’s interests and hold the other party accountable.
Why is Handling Contract Disputes Important? 📝
- Protects Business Relationships: Resolving disputes amicably keeps professional relationships intact.
- Reduces Costs: Preventing costly litigation helps save your startup money.
- Ensures Business Continuity: Resolving disputes promptly allows your startup to continue growing without unnecessary delays.
